SITE PURPOSE:
This website was created by a first year student and prospective International Relations major at Mount Holyoke College. This was a final assignment for Vincent Ferraro's introductory World Politics course. It was created for the purpose of analyzing the relationship between cell phone use and the reduction of poverty. My hope is to contribute to the discussion of the topic and provide a resource for those interested. I am intrigued by alternative methods to fighting poverty and feel that this particular topic asserts the need for us to reassess both our current strategy of aiding developing nations and reflect on our use of technology.
